编程比赛叫什么项目
-
编程比赛有很多不同的项目,以下是一些常见的编程比赛项目:
-
算法竞赛:算法竞赛项目要求参赛者解决一系列算法问题,通过编写高效的算法来求解。这类比赛通常注重参赛者对算法的理解和分析能力。
-
数据挖掘竞赛:数据挖掘竞赛要求参赛者分析给定的大型数据集,挖掘出有用的信息或解决特定问题。参赛者需要使用机器学习、统计学等数据分析方法来进行数据处理和模型构建。
-
应用开发竞赛:这类竞赛要求参赛者在限定时间内开发出特定领域的应用程序。比如,移动应用开发竞赛,要求参赛者开发创新的手机应用;Web 开发竞赛,要求参赛者构建功能丰富的网站。
-
物联网竞赛:物联网竞赛要求参赛者利用传感器、嵌入式系统等技术,开发出具有智能化、互联互通能力的物联网应用。这类比赛需求参赛者在硬件和软件方面都具备一定的技能。
-
人工智能竞赛:人工智能竞赛要求参赛者通过编写智能算法或设计深度学习模型来解决特定问题。比如,图像识别竞赛,要求参赛者开发出能够准确识别图像内容的算法或模型。
-
嵌入式系统竞赛:嵌入式系统竞赛要求参赛者设计和实现嵌入式硬件和软件系统。参赛者需要将各个硬件模块进行集成并编写相应的嵌入式软件。
-
游戏开发竞赛:游戏开发竞赛要求参赛者在规定时间内开发出创新、有趣的游戏作品。参赛者需要具备游戏设计和编程技能。
以上是一些常见的编程比赛项目,每个项目都有其特定的要求和挑战,参赛者可以根据自己的兴趣和技能选择适合自己的项目参加。
1年前 -
-
编程比赛可以有多种不同的项目,以下是五个常见的编程比赛项目:
-
算法竞赛:算法竞赛是最经典的编程比赛项目之一。参赛者需要解决一系列算法问题,包括排序、搜索、动态规划等。这类比赛常常注重参赛者对算法的理解和实现能力。
-
软件开发竞赛:软件开发竞赛要求参赛者在规定的时间内,使用给定的开发工具和编程语言开发出一个完整的软件应用或系统。这类比赛注重参赛者的软件开发能力和项目管理能力。
-
数据分析竞赛:数据分析竞赛要求参赛者根据给定的数据集,利用统计分析和数据挖掘技术解决实际问题。这类比赛注重参赛者对数据分析技术和相关领域知识的应用能力。
-
人工智能竞赛:人工智能竞赛要求参赛者使用机器学习和深度学习算法,解决相关的人工智能问题,如图像识别、自然语言处理等。这类比赛注重参赛者对机器学习算法和数据处理技术的掌握。
-
多人在线竞技对战游戏开发竞赛:这类比赛要求参赛者使用特定的游戏引擎和开发工具,开发一个具有特定功能和规则的多人在线对战游戏。这类比赛注重参赛者对游戏开发技术和网络编程的理解和应用能力。
以上是一些常见的编程比赛项目,不同的比赛项目有不同的要求和挑战,参赛者可以根据自己的兴趣和能力选择适合的项目参赛。
1年前 -
-
编程比赛通常被称为编程竞赛或编程挑战赛。在不同的细分领域中,还有一些特定的编程比赛项目,具体的项目名称可能会有所不同。以下是一些常见的编程比赛项目名称:
-
ACM国际大学生程序设计竞赛(ACM ICPC):ACM ICPC是一项面向大学生的程序设计竞赛,参赛队伍需要通过解决一系列算法和数据结构相关的问题来获得高分。这个比赛通常由学校或地区的选拔赛、区域赛和国际赛三个阶段组成。
-
TopCoder竞赛:TopCoder是一个在线编程竞赛平台,提供了一系列不同水平的编程挑战,包括算法竞赛、组件竞赛和马拉松竞赛等。参赛者可以通过解决各种问题来获得积分和排名。
-
Google Code Jam:Google Code Jam是一项由谷歌举办的全球性编程竞赛,参赛者需要通过解决一系列算法和编程问题来晋级和获得奖金。这个比赛通常包括限时编程和算法优化等环节。
-
Facebook Hacker Cup:Facebook Hacker Cup是由Facebook组织的年度编程竞赛,旨在找到全球最有天赋的程序员。参赛者需要通过解决一系列程序设计问题来晋级,最终争夺世界冠军。
-
Codeforces竞赛:Codeforces是一个开放式的在线编程竞赛平台,每周都会举办各种不同难度和规模的编程比赛。参赛者需要在限定时间内解决一系列问题,获得积分和排名。
-
区域性和地方性编程比赛:除了以上全球性的编程竞赛,许多地区和国家还举办各种规模的区域性和地方性编程比赛。这些比赛通常由学校、公司、协会等组织,旨在促进编程技能的发展和交流。
这些编程比赛项目涵盖了不同的编程领域和技能要求,可以选择适合自己兴趣和水平的项目参加,提升自己的编程能力和解决问题的能力。
1年前 -